Description for Toad Lake, Whatcom County, Washington

Toad Lake is a lake located just 3.2 miles from Geneva, in Whatcom County, in the state of Washington, United States, near Bellingham, WA. Whether you’re fly fishing, baitcasting or spinning your chances of getting a bite here are good. So grab your favorite fly fishing rod and reel, and head out to Toad Lake. Alternate names for this lake include Emerald Lake.
